What is Mailchimp?
All-in-one marketing platform for growing businessesMailchimp is the SMB email marketing leader (Intuit-owned) used by 13M+ businesses worldwide. Drag-and-drop email builder, marketing automation, landing pages, surveys, transactional email, and SMS in one platform. Pricing: Free (500 contacts), Essentials $13/mo, Standard $20/mo, Premium $350/mo. Strong template library, brand-recognized, but climbs in cost vs ESPs like Brevo at scale. Owned by Intuit since 2021.

-Weaknesses
- โFree plan severely limited to just 250 contacts and 500 emails per month
- โCharges for unsubscribed and inactive contacts, inflating costs unnecessarily
- โDuplicate contacts across audiences count separately for billing purposes
- โAutomation features are basic on lower tiers, requiring expensive upgrades for workflows
- โLimited design flexibility and template customization options compared to competitors
